Key cost
If your Lexus keyfob doesn't work anymore or is not working, you may need an upgrade. This could be due to a malfunctioning circuitry or physical damage, based on the root cause. A key fob that is exposed to extreme temperatures or rain may also be damaged.
The most modern Lexus models are equipped with a transponder or smart key that is designed to replace the traditional keys made of metal. The keys communicate with the computer of the car, allowing drivers to unlock doors and turn on the engine. They can also perform passive functions such as locking the driver door with the press of the button, or activating the trunk release by using the foot.
In the event of an emergency, you should have your registration and vehicle identification number (VIN) on hand to prove your ownership. This will assist locksmiths or dealers to cut new keys and program it.

Cost of the transponder key
Transponder keys were introduced in 1997 for most Lexus models. These are essentially a laser cut key with a chip inside which transmits a specific code to the vehicle every time it is pressed. Without this code the car will not start. This type of key is more expensive to replace than a standard one and requires special programming. Locksmiths are fortunate to have the needed tools to complete this task for 20% less than a dealer would.
The key and the paired fob communicate with each other through an RF signal to open the door of the driver and trunk and arm and disarm the security system, and even start the engine. The majority of Lexus vehicles are equipped with Smart key fobs, which contain an RFID chip that transmits an encrypted code to the vehicle to unlock or lock the doors and start the engine. The keys can also trigger an alarm system or a panic button. But, these chips can be damaged by exposure to water and other elements. These chips can also be damaged by mechanical damage caused by dropping keys or other mishaps.
Make sure to bring your identity and registration documents in case you're required to replace a Lexus keyfob. Dealers will require your driver's licence and VIN number to confirm that you own the vehicle. A locksmith will need the same documents for similar services, but they are usually less expensive than the dealership.
